Handover for tonight: the dedupe job on CustomerForge finished its third pass over the Marnell accounts. Fuzzy-match threshold was lowered yesterday, so expect more merge candidates in the review queue. Don't rerun the batch before the queue clears or you'll double-merge. If the worker stalls, restart it with the settings below. These are the config values it expects.

service settings:
PRAIX_LOG_LEVEL=error
PRAIX_METRICS_HOST=metrics.praix.qorvelcorp.corp
PRAIX_POOL_SIZE=16

## Who to ping about GiftNote

Welcome aboard! GiftNote is our donation-receipt mailer for the Larchfield Fund. Template tweaks go to the comms folks; delivery failures and bounce weirdness go to the platform crew. Don't push template changes on Fridays — receipts batch over the weekend. For anything GiftNote-related, start with the address below.

billing contact of kaweg-tajeg = drudor.lamion.oliath@torvalabs.test

TURN-208: Gatevale turnstile counters at the Merrow Field pilot double-count when a rotation reverses mid-cycle. Attendance totals drift roughly 2% high per event. The debounce window fix is implemented, reviewed by Ilsa, and soak-tested across two simulated match days without drift. Ready for your cut; the candidate build is identified below.

trace token, tagag-tafog: htk6_5ed18c